CAMERON ARAGON
"I know you get this all the time, but your last name is so cool!"
Cameron was born in central California, the home of country music and agriculture. After high school she swapped the cowboy boots for snow boots. She moved to Salt Lake City, Utah where she earned her BFA in Musical Theatre from the University of Utah.
After graduation she swapped the snow boots for a nice pair of stilettos (much more her style) and moved to New York City where she now resides.
Cameron just wrapped up her second national tour. She performed as William in Nickelodeon's "Baby Shark's Big Broadwave Tour."
When not performing, she loves to catch a good happy hour, spend quality time with friends and family, and spa days.
